DRUZY QUARTZ
(Alternate Names: Drusy Quartz, Druze Quartz, Fairy Quartz Surface)
Appearance
A glittering layer of tiny quartz crystals coating the surface of a host stone, creating a sparkling, sugar-like texture. Colors range from clear and white to smoky, gray, or subtly tinted depending on the base mineral. The crystals are minute but numerous, catching light from every angle and giving the stone a lively, effervescent presence.

How to Tell Real from Fake
Real Druzy Quartz:
– Naturally uneven crystal coverage
– Points grown directly from the stone
– Cool, mineral feel
Fakes or imitations:
– Uniform sparkle glued to a base
– Resin coatings
– Crystals that flake off easily
If the sparkle feels grown, not applied, it’s genuine.
